Maastricht's artistic Maastricht-Centre Urban District neighborhood is loved for its churches and theaters, and visitors often enjoy its varied attractions including Market and Basilica of Our Lady.
Maastricht's Binnenstad neighborhood is known for its theaters and concert halls, and entices visitors with attractions including Vrijthof and Museum aan het Vrijthof.
Maastricht's trendy Wyck neighborhood is loved for its bars and riverfront, and visitors often enjoy its varied attractions including Bonnefanten Museum and Centre Ceramique.
Maastricht's Randwijck neighborhood is known for its restaurants and offers a host of things to see such as Mecc Maastricht and Maastricht Exhibition and Congress Centre.

Meander through cobblestone streets lined with medieval architecture and bustling cafes in this historic university town. Explore underground caves, climb St. John's Church tower, or join a guided tour of the impressive Town Hall.
